2.5 Precautionary measures for handling units with lithium batteries
- Do not short-circuit and charge batteries: danger of explosion
- Do not throw units which contain batteries into fire: danger of explosion
- Do not subject batteries to mechanical stress and do not dismantle them. The leaking battery fluid is highly
corrosive and lithium can generate severe heat when it comes into contact with moisture or it can ignite fire.
- Do not heat up battery-driven units to temperatures exceeding 100°C: danger of explosion
- Avoid violent knocks and blows
- Follow the manufacturer's specifications for storing batteries
- Return batteries to the supplier for correct waste disposal

2.7 Logger display / power-save mode
The ECOLOG-NET datalogger has a power-save mode which switches off the display. As a result,
measurements are only made during the defined log interval. 1 circling element (...H2) or 4 small circles
(...P4) located in the display for the measured values indicate that the datalogger is still functioning correctly.
The elproLOG ANALYZE Software - Extended Setup - Display mode / Powersave - is responsible for
switching this mode on and off. ...P4 datalogger types go automatically into power-save mode when no
external power supply is available. If you need to make a check, you can use the keypad to switch the display
on temporarily.
2.8 Threshold values function /
The ECOLOG-NET datalogger has a feature for monitoring threshold values. The threshold values are
defined separately for each individual sensor
The ECOLOG-NET may signal a violation of threshold values in various ways:
a) On an active display a threshold violation is shown with
They are visible for the actual duration of the threshold violation only. This status is not logged.
b) The following text is displayed if the conditions for an alarm are fulfilled: ALARM
It is dependent on the selected alarm output (self-sustaining) and display mode.
c)
In the case of an alarm being triggered, the ECOLOG-NET has a collective alarm function. This function
is activated simultaneously when the following text display is triggered: ALARM. For a more detailed
description of this function,
Acknowledge the alarm messages manually using the PC software or the keypad.
- During normal operation, the threshold values are checked every 4 seconds or at
the defined log interval if a shorter time has been set.
- In power-save mode, the threshold values are checked either in 1 minute cycles if the
log interval is longer than 1 minute or at the defined log interval if shorter intervals
have been set. The following text is displayed in power-save mode when the relevant
conditions are fulfilled: ALARM and, in addition, ALA.
- Threshold values are no longer monitored when the datalogger is in Stop mode.
